15 Texas Holdem Poker Tips to increase your Bankroll .

 

If you’re learning how to play Texas Holdem or even if you’ve been playing Texas Holdem for awhile , here are 15 of our favorite tips on how to play Texas Holdem better than you’ve ever played it before …

1. Don’t play tournaments that cost more than 5% or your bankroll. bigger ones will deplete it too fast . You’ll have a better chance of going broke if you lose .

2. Don’t play no limit cash games with players with more than double the buy-in limit . You’ll be at risk to get busted .

3. In live poker games , you should have at least 200 times the big blind in your bankroll to play in a cash game. That will keep you in the game long enough to deal with your win/loss .

4. For online poker games , have at least 400 times the big blind to play a cash game . The nature of the online game makes for a wider win/loss variance.

5. When buying into a new poker room , bonus options will give you more action for your playing dollar and keep you in the game that much longer.

6. Save your player points for something you really like, or entry into a bigger tournament . Maximize your freebies , a gift is better than a pile of cheap tournaments .

7. When playing a re-buy event, decide how many re-buys you want ahead of time and only take that amount to the game. Don’t re-buy too many times into the same event.

8. Don’t cash out money in your bankroll, the bigger it grows the bigger the action you’ll be able to play, and there fore the more money you’ll be able to make.

9. Reload bonuses offered by the poker room are not always available and should be utilized when they are offered. check out the terms of the bonus always .

10. Freeroll tournaments and invitational events that the online poker room might be offering is pure profit with no risk to your bankroll.

11. Get out of a game that’s not allowing you to play your style successfully . Most likely it won’t change so find a better game where you can be comfortable and make some money.

12. Create a scheduled amount for the week so you can control what you’re playing with . Stick to the planned amount unless you’ve made some profit during that week .

13. Find out where you have the most success and keep track of your games . Spend most of your playing time playing that game you profit at .

14. Steal bets from the scared players and trap the aggressive ones . Play tight games with a loose style and play loose games with a tight style .

15. Don’t stay in the big cash games with small money , jump down in stakes levels if your bankroll depletes below the amount required for the table or you’ll be broke in no time.
